In the autumn of 2020, the government invested SEK 2.2 billion in elderly care and even more in 2021. This, among other things, was to be able to train more care workers as assistant nurses.

Strängnäs is one of the municipalities that received the grant, which made it possible that the former temporary substitute Lidia Maka now has a permanent job at the nursing home Riagården in Strängnäs.

Part-time studies

The training is aimed at those who already work in elderly care and is carried out during paid working hours.
